Team: effective Q3, Harrowfield Software moves default contracts from monthly to annual billing. Rationale: cash predictability and lower churn on the Strandia tier. Discounts capped at 8% for annual prepay; anything deeper needs my sign-off. Existing monthly accounts grandfathered until renewal. Expect pushback from mid-market; talk tracks go out Friday. Pipeline forecasts must reflect the new terms by end of month. No external comms until legal clears the templates. Context on why we are moving now follows below.

management briefing: Project Ulavan slips by two quarters because of the staffing delay.

**Onboarding note: Landlord site audit (Corven Estates)**

Twice a year, Corven Estates conducts a compliance audit of the Melling Point offices, checking fire exits, signage, and access logs. Team assistants should escort the auditors at all times and log their arrival with reception. Auditors are not issued visitor badges for restricted floors; instead, assistants open doors on their behalf. Please clear desks of confidential papers the evening before. To admit the audit party through the service corridor, use the code below.

turnstile pass: bdg-QZV-3

## Signing ChipGate builds

Quick reminder for the sync: firmware for the Larkspan ChipGate reader (the thing at the finish line that reads timing chips) now refuses unsigned images. The race-day ops folks got burned by a stale build at the Verrow Bay marathon, so no exceptions. Flash tooling checks the signature automatically. Sign every image with the key below.

rollout seal: bky19_M1Zvn1YQwEBTy4XxP3H

### Key Ceremony Checklist — Item 7 (Plugin Authors)

Applies to all external plugins targeting the Driftgate flag-rollout framework. Before the ceremony: verify your plugin manifest pins the Driftgate SDK to the ceremony-approved version. No dynamic flag names. No runtime flag creation. Confirm your rollout hooks are idempotent — the ceremony replays them. Sign the attestation form witnessed by two Driftgate stewards. Then unseal your plugin signing shard using the recovery passphrase that appears immediately below this item.

unlock words, hahip-baduf: holwyn-istath-julvan